Getting an accurate diagnosis is the first step to managing ADHD symptoms. You can speak to a specialist in private about your symptoms, including those that you might not be aware of, and how they affect your daily life. This will enable your doctor to determine the most effective treatment for you, be it medication or specialist coaching.

The evaluation usually begins with a a structured consultation with the clinician. You'll be asked to bring notes about your experiences as well as any other mental health issues you suffer from, as they may look similar to ADHD (for example, autism or PTSD). The doctor should also be aware about the mental health history of your family members which could be a cause for concern.

Your doctor will typically use one or more of the standardized rating scales to measure your behavior in various situations. These tests compare your behavior to that of people without ADHD and can be a valuable instrument in the assessment process. The doctor will also inquire about your education and your working life to understand how you function and what issues your symptoms may cause.

Your clinician will then discuss the results of your assessment and then decide on the next step. They may suggest medical or specialist coaching or a shared-care protocol with your GP after you've stabilized on your medication. During the appointment, your psychiatrist will ask questions about your family history health and development, from birth along with your work, education and social life. They will also try to determine if there are any other conditions that might cause similar symptoms such as anxiety or depression.

They'll likely be pretty sure that you have ADHD within the first couple of minutes after your appointment begins and the majority of the consultation will consist of a discussion of the various issues that you raise. You will be asked to provide examples of your problems, and how they affect your functioning. They will also ask you about your previous experiences and any mental health issues that are in your family.

The Psychiatrist you consult with uses the information you provide to determine if you are eligible for an ADHD diagnosis. If they don't believe you are suffering from ADHD they will explain why and recommend another diagnostic option. It can be difficult but remember that it is your right to ask for another opinion.

Once they have decided that you suffer from ADHD and have a plan for the best course of action with medication and therapy, they will discharge you back to your GP. They usually do this if you're happy to return for regular follow-up appointments, however, they don't have to do this if you don't want to.

Before you make an appointment, make sure your GP is in agreement with a "shared-care" agreement. You will have to pay for the initial treatment however, if the results prove positive, your GP can prescribe the medication through the NHS.
